Scott Volmer

The importance of nature in our lives is second only to happy interaction with other people. The same energies that move in nature inform my design process for landscapes: color, season, nuance, history, light, change, growth, contrast, memory and climate. A well designed landscape should give you a sense of pride, belonging, delight; a place of relaxation and safety. I feel strongly that landscapes should speak to their larger setting and work easily to reduce the input of labor, water, chemicals and materials that are suddenly more precious on a shrinking planet. 

I think everyone should have a favorite garden place, right now.
